Abstract
In this book, we emphasized the chiral nature of the SM. The orbifold construction has been discussed toward obtaining three family models from the E8 ×E′8 heterotic string. But there are other methods also for obtaining 4D string models. Among these, we review very briefly on the fermionic construction and the interesting brane setup. Since obtaining three families is one of the most important objectives going beyond 4D, we discuss these other constructions up to the point of introducing the possibility for three families. We do not attempt to review the whole ideas and realistic model buildings.
